Rapid CD transfer device
For those nifty new gadgets.

These Ipods hold lots of songs. But how to get the songs off the CDs onto the Ipod? One disc at a time? All that disc changing is for chumps.

The Rapid CD Transfer device holds a stack of all your old favorite discs. One at a time these are loaded, read, and stored on your Ipod or computer.

Since you only need the thing once, it would be available for rent.
